[fusion-trac] #126: Double Map Name in Custom Tasks
Fusion
trac_fusion at osgeo.org
Tue Sep 16 16:01:57 EDT 2008
#126: Double Map Name in Custom Tasks
------------------------+---------------------------------------------------
Reporter: cgountanis | Owner: madair
Type: defect | Status: new
Priority: P2 | Milestone: 1.1
Component: MapGuide | Version: 1.0.7
Severity: Major | Resolution:
Keywords: | External_id:
State: Approved | Browser: All
Os: All |
------------------------+---------------------------------------------------
Changes (by pagameba):
* state: Analysis Requested => Approved
Comment:
Actually, I spoke too soon - I was looking in Studio for something else
and realized that there are two widgets in play here, TaskPane and
InvokeURL, and it turns out that both of them are adding the three
parameters to the URL. I'm not sure which widget's implementation is
better, but "there can only be one"!
Thinking this through a little, InvokeURL can open a page in either the
task pane or another frame or a separate window, so it needs to add the
parameters. Other widgets like BufferPanel can do the same. I think that
the extra parameters should be removed from the code in TaskPane.
Mike, please review this and see if there are any other widgets that can
target the taskpane that don't add the parameters and adjust them to add
the parameters, then remove that code from TaskPane.
--
Ticket URL: <http://trac.osgeo.org/fusion/ticket/126#comment:2>
Fusion <http://trac.osgeo.org/fusion>
Fusion is a web-mapping application development framework for MapServer and MapGuide OS.
More information about the fusion-trac
mailing list